CHAPTER 8

Industry Knows How to Adapt and Will Remain Competitive

Industry Knows How to Adapt

Leaders in manufacturing and distribution have proven that companies can progress toward aggressive targets if top management supports the initiatives.

The largest area of focus should be upstream in the supply chain, at the producers. This is where the most impact can be had, and where the impact can be realized the fastest.

The oil industry’s acceptance of, and active participation in the design of, a carbon tax could break a deadlock in governing the single largest and most important externality discussed in this book. It should be encouraged and promoted at all levels.
